HFST-LEXC(1)			 User Commands			  HFST-LEXC(1)

NAME
       hfst-lexc - =Compile lexc files into transducer

SYNOPSIS
       hfst-lexc [OPTIONS...] [INFILE1...]]

DESCRIPTION
       Compile lexc files into transducer

   Common options:
       -h, --help
	      Print help message

       -V, --version
	      Print version info

       -v, --verbose
	      Print verbosely while processing

       -q, --quiet
	      Only print fatal erros and requested output

       -s, --silent
	      Alias of --quiet

   Input/Output options:
       -f, --format=FORMAT
	      compile into FORMAT transducer

       -o, --output=OUTFILE
	      write result into OUTFILE

   Lexc options:
       -F, --withFlags
	      use flags to hyperminimize result

       -M, --minimizeFlags
	      if --withFlags is used, minimize the number of flags

       -R, --renameFlags
	      if  --withFlags  and --minimizeFlags are used, rename flags (for
	      testing)

       -x, --xerox-composition=VALUE Whether flag diacritics  are  treated  as
       ordinary
	      symbols in composition (default is true).

       -X, --xfst=VARIABLE
	      toggle xfst compatibility option VARIABLE.

       -W, --Werror
	      treat warnings as errors

       If  INFILE  or  OUTFILE are omitted or -, standard streams will be used
       The possible values for FORMAT  are  {  sfst,  openfst-tropical,	 open‐
       fst-log,	 foma,	optimized-lookup-unweighted, optimized-lookup-weighted
       }.  VALUEs recognized are {true,ON,yes} and {false,OFF,no}.  Xfst vari‐
       ables are {flag-is-epsilon (default OFF)}.

EXAMPLES
       hfst-lexc -o cat.hfst cat.lexc
	      Compile single-file lexicon

       hfst-lexc -o L.hfst Root.lexc 2.lexc 3.lexc
	      Compile multi-file lexicon

   Using weights:
	      LEXICON  Root  cat  #  "weight: 2" ;    Define weight for a word
	      <[dog::1]+> # ;	     Use weights in regular expressions

       Using weights has an effect only if FORMAT is weighted, i.e.   {	 open‐
       fst-tropical, openfst-log, optimized-lookup-weighted }.
